I have a smiter with HoZ. Hovering my mouse over the shield itself reveals "Chance to Block: 75%," but when I hover my mouse over "Defense" in the character attributes window (click "c") it only shows "Chance to Block: 33%". When I do Holy Shield it brings this number up to 44% even though on the HoZ the chance to block remains at 75%. Is max block determined by what the shield says or by what the attribute box says?

By what the attribute box says. The number that hoz says is only the shields base chance to block. Difrent shields have difrent base blocking.

Your chance to block is counted with the following formula.

Total Blocking = [(Blocking * (Dexterity - 15)) / (Character Level * 2)]

Blocking = A total of the Blocking on all of your items. (E.g: Guardian Angel, Twitchthroe, Any Shield, Holy Shield)
[] = Round Down

Note: Blocking on shield shown in game is capped at 75% while it may actually be higher. For a true account of most shields blocking ability... Look here forUnique, Set, and Magical/Rare shields. (for magical/rare, add the Blocking % from the suffix to the base blocking)
